Detailed explanation-1: -What is theology? Theology is the study of religion. It examines the human experience of faith, and how different people and cultures express it. Theologians examine the many different religions of the world and their impact on society.

Detailed explanation-2: -Theology in a Christian context seeks to understand the God revealed in the Bible. So, the study of God is a study of God’s revelation of Himself. Theology is essentially a study of scripture. Theology comes from combining two Greek words: theos, meaning God, and logos, meaning word or rational thought.

Detailed explanation-3: -Theology is the critical study of the nature of the divine; more generally, Religion refers to any cultural system of worship that relates humanity to the supernatural or transcendental.

Detailed explanation-4: -What Is Theology? Virtually all religions contain theology. Etymologically, theology is the study of God. However, it’s usually understood more broadly, particularly in terms of interpretation of key beliefs, teachings, writings, practices, and so on.
